CANopen _ CiA Draft Standard Proposal 402
文件大小: 661k
源码售价: 10 个金币 积分规则     积分充值
资源说明:CANopen协议402,设备配置文件驱动器与运动控制 CiA Draft Standard Proposal 402是针对CANopen通信协议的一个设备配置文件,专门针对驱动器和运动控制的应用。这个草案标准提案并不建议直接实施,其版本为2.0,发布日期为2005年3月17日。该文档由CAN in Automation e.V.(CiA)组织编写,该组织关注可能存在专利权的问题,但不负责识别所有可能涉及的专利。 CANopen是一种在CAN(Controller Area Network)总线上的高层通信协议,广泛应用于工业自动化领域。CANopen协议402定义了驱动器和运动控制设备的一系列通信和服务,使得不同制造商的设备能够互操作,确保了系统的兼容性和标准化。 文档的历史记录显示,自2002年7月以来,文档进行了全面修订。主要变更包括: 1. 插入记录定义0080h:插值时间周期记录,用于控制电机的平滑速度变化。 2. 插入记录定义0081h:插值数据配置记录,定义了数据如何进行插值计算以实现精确的运动控制。 3. 插入记录定义0082h:最大速度、加速度和减速度记录,用于控制电机的速度变化特性。 4. 对象6406h的数据类型从DATE更改为TIME_OF_DAY,可能用于设置或读取运动控制的时间参数。 5. 对象60C1h、60F9h和60FEh的对象代码从RECORD更改为ARRAY,表明这些对象的数据结构有所调整,可能涉及数据的存储和处理方式。 6. 对象6089h至608Eh的类别从可选更改为条件性,意味着这些对象的使用依赖于特定条件。 7. 对象6084h和606Ah的类别分别从强制性更改为可选,这意味着这些功能不再是设备必须提供的。 文档还强调了版权信息,未经许可,任何部分都不能以任何形式复制或使用,除非得到CiA的书面许可。 CiA DSP 402标准的范围涵盖了驱动器和运动控制的各个方面,包括但不限于设备配置、错误处理、网络管理、实时通信以及诊断服务。通过定义一系列对象字典和通信服务,它规定了如何在CANopen网络上进行驱动器的参数设置、状态监控、命令发送和反馈接收。 在实际应用中,CANopen 402允许用户实现精确的伺服驱动、步进电机、直流电机或其他类型的运动控制设备的编程和控制,确保了复杂的自动化系统中的高效运动控制。同时,由于其开放性和标准化,CANopen 402降低了设备间的集成成本,提高了系统的可靠性。 总结来说,CANopen协议402是驱动器和运动控制设备通信的重要规范,通过定义和标准化通信接口,促进了设备间的互操作性,为工业自动化领域的广泛应用提供了坚实的基础。
本源码包内暂不包含可直接显示的源代码文件,请下载源码包。